[Effect of basic soil cultivation on productivity of winter wheat and silage maize in the zone of Polissya (Forest-Steppe) of Ukraine]
1998
Lychuk, H.I. (Institute of Agriculture, Chabany, Kyiv region (Ukraine))
In the Ukraine's Polissya zone on a derno-podzolic sandy loam soil in a stationary trial, established in 1972 at Kopylovo Experimental Station of the Institute of Agriculture, long-term mineral fertilizer application, especially when using nonmoldboard cultivation, was found out to lead to deterioration of physical and chemical properties of the soil to a greater degree than at ploughing. Liming, especially compensating one (for 1 kg NH4NO3 - 2.5 kg CaCO3), is determined to favour for increase in effectiveness of fertilizers at ploughing by 11.5 %, at nonmoldboard cultivation - 53.8 %. As a result the gain in yield was achieved as follows: at ploughing from 33.2 c/ha to 42.2 c/ha, at nonmoldboard cultivation from 21.3 c/ha to 45.9 c/ha
